Gryphon Gold Reports Treasury Increase from Exercise of Warrants

September 22, 2009Vancouver, BC. Gryphon Gold Corporation (GGN: TSX; GYPH: OTC.BB) (the "Company") is pleased to announce that it has received proceeds of CDN$1,289,070 from the recent exercise of 7,161,500 amended warrants, increasing the Company’s treasury to a total of USD$1,046,181.

As announced on July 8, 2009, Gryphon Gold amended the terms of the previously issued warrants to provide for an extension of the expiry date and a reduction of the exercise price, entitling the holders to acquire (on exercise) an aggregate of 9,486,500 shares of common stock, representing about 15% of the outstanding common shares (basic). The Company is pleased that 75% of these amended warrants have been exercised to date, refreshing the treasury and allowing for the continued advancement of the wholly owned Borealis Oxide Project in Nevada. A Pre-Feasibility Study for the proposed low-cost, open-pit mine, with expected average annual production of more than 50,000 gold-equivalent ounces, has been filed on the SEDAR website, www.sedar.com.

ABOUT GRYPHON GOLD:

Gryphon Gold is a Nevada-focused gold exploration and potentially a production company. Its principal gold resource, the 1.4 million ounce (377,356 ounces of proven and probable reserves and 1,022,644 ounces of measured and indicated) and 1.1 million ounce (inferred) Borealis deposits, is located in the Walker Lane gold belt of western Nevada. The Borealis gold system is one of the largest known volcanic-hosted high-sulphidation gold bearing mineralized systems in Nevada. Nevada Eagle Resources, a wholly owned subsidiary, has approximately 60 highly prospective gold properties located in desirable gold trends in Nevada. Nevada Eagle’s Golden Arrow property (leased to Nevada Sunrise Gold Corp.) contains a NI 43-101 compliant resource of 296,500 ounces of gold (measured and indicated1) and 50,400 inferred ounces of gold1. Nevada Eagle's other principal properties have a cumulative 1,365,000 of historical ounces of gold (the historical estimates are based on internal reports prepared by prior owners prior to February, 2001, and were not prepared in accordance with CIM NI 43-101 standards, and thus their reliability has not been verified). A number of Nevada Eagle’s principal properties are subject to joint venture or farm-in agreements in favor of third parties.

All mineral resources have been estimated in accordance with the definition standards on mineral resources and mineral reserves of the Canadian Institute of Mining, Metallurgy and Petroleum referred to in National Instrument 43-101, commonly referred to as NI 43-101. U.S. reporting requirements for disclosure of mineral properties are governed by the United States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) Industry Guide 7. Canadian and Guide 7 standards are substantially different and the information contained in this press release is not comparable to similar information disclosed by U.S. companies This press release and the Pre-Feasibility Study referenced in this press release uses the terms "measured," "indicated," and "inferred" resources. We advise investors that while those terms are recognized and required by Canadian regulations, the SEC does not recognize them. Inferred mineral resources are considered too speculative geologically to have economic considerations applied to them that enable them to be categorized as mineral reserves. It cannot be assumed that all or any part of an inferred mineral resource will ever be upgraded to a higher category. Under Canadian rules, estimates of inferred mineral resources may not form the basis of feasibility or pre-feasibility studies, except in rare cases. U.S. investors are cautioned not to assume that part or all of an inferred resource exists, or is economically or legally minable. U.S. investors are cautioned not to assume that any part or all of mineral deposits in these categories will ever be converted into reserves.
